IBM is pleased to invite students to participate in the Linux Scholar
Challenge contest, where they can solve real-world issues and learn how to
improve today's open source environments.

Prizes are as follows:

Winners will receive one of 25 IBM ThinkPads
Three qualified winners will be offered Summer 2002 internships at IBM's
Linux Technology Center
For the university with the highest average score of student entries (with
a minimum of 10 entries), a choice of a 16-node Linux Cluster or
entry-level IBM  zSeries Linux server
